Financial Performance Highlights
Consolidated Financials Q1 FY27:
- Revenue: ₹281 crores (vs. ₹247 crores in Q1 FY26), growth of 14%
- EBITDA: ₹83 crores (vs. ₹70 crores in Q1 FY26), growth of 18%
- EBITDA Margin: 29.7% (120 bps improvement YoY)
- Profit After Tax: ₹48 crores (vs. ₹41 crores in Q1 FY26), growth of 17%
- PAT Margin: 17.1% (40 bps improvement YoY)
Segment-wise Performance
Healthcare Segment:
- Revenue: ₹142 crores (85% YoY growth from ₹77 crores)
- Contribution: 51% of consolidated revenue (became largest segment)
- Growth driven by pen injector platform including GLP-1 and chronic therapy devices
- Shipped approximately 9 million medical devices in Q1 FY27
- Product mix: 50-60% GLP-1 devices, remainder insulin and other molecules
Consumer Segment:
- Revenue: ₹116 crores (24% decline from ₹151 crores in Q1 FY26)
- Contribution: 41% of consolidated revenue
- Decline due to softer demand in home furnishings across Europe and United States
- Secured global project from FMCG customer and won new business in LED lighting segment
Industrial Segment:
- Revenue: ₹23 crores (25% YoY growth from ₹18 crores)
- Growth supported by new customer additions and engineering applications including Consumer Electronics
- Received business confirmations for new projects from Appliance and Automotive customers
- Onboarded new customer with orders covering 5 Consumer Electronic components
Operational Metrics
- Machine utilization improved to 50.2% in Q1 FY27 vs. 48.7% in Q1 FY26
- Export contribution: 58% of consolidated revenue (vs. 76% in Q1 FY26)
- Change due to growing Healthcare business supplied through Indian pharmaceutical customers to global markets
Capacity Expansion Update
- Additional 25 million pen capacity expected operational by end-September 2026
- Total installed pen injector capacity to reach approximately 75 million pens per annum
- Current production line efficiency improved by 9%, expecting further 30% jump with additional equipment
- New line strategy modified: ramp-up to 80%+ efficiency at supplier before FAT and shipment

New Product Development Pipeline
Emergency Use Auto-injectors:
- Targeting epinephrine and other confidential molecules
- Requires 99.999% reliability for automatic injection, dose delivery and retraction
- Expected completion by end of 2027
Reusable Auto-injectors:
- Addressing sustainability (1 billion auto-injectors landfilled annually)
- Performance testing scheduled for current month or early next month
- First showcase at CPHI Milan
On-body Injectors:
- Targeting oncology treatments with 3ml to 15/23ml delivery range
- For biologics/biosimilars
- Currently under development and partnership discussions
Consumer Electronics & Semiconductor Business
- Started commercial supply for Consumer Electronics
- Awarded 5 new components from new customer
- New plant location secured (not disclosed)
- Revenue target of $10 million expected within 24-30 months
- Semiconductor trays investment: ₹5 crores in existing facility
- Future Consumer Electronics plant investment: ₹80-100 crores
- Semiconductor revenue expected to start from Q4 FY27
Market Position and Competitive Landscape
- Confident of maintaining dominant position in Canada and significant share in Brazil
- Chinese competition pricing at $1.50-$1.70 vs. Shaily's above $2.00
- Pricing contracts include annual review mechanism, not cost-plus
- Device performance feedback described as "above average, good" with minimal issues

Forward-looking Commentary
- Expect to exceed full-year guidance of 36 million devices
- Gross margin normalization expected by Q3 FY27
- Abu Dhabi facility targeted for production by end-FY28
- 50-55% capacity commitments already secured for Abu Dhabi
- Consumer business expected to maintain FY26 levels in current year
